Mindful golf, practical wisdom

Combining ancient wisdom with a light and humorous touch, this guide invites players to start with heart and mind before the swing. Readers are guided through stories drawn from Buddhist parables, imaginative exercises, and sensory training that make practice feel like play. While the approach is not presented as a quick fix or guarantee, it opens up possibilities for calmer focus on the course and in daily life.
